First is this vintage oil painting. I thought it was really a beautifully done painting but the ugly, gouged up frame was really bringing it down.

Before...


I sanded the nicks out of the frame and gave it a coat of white paint. Doesn't it look pretty now!? I think it would look beautiful in a beach cottage!

After...


I also picked up this vintage crewel embroidery picture at the same time. Again... the frame... it's bringing me down man!

Before...


But look at it now! I chose an avocado green for the frame to bring out the green in the picture. Oh, you should see this thing in person... someone did a beautiful job... so much intricate work and layers... I would have pulled my hair out after about the 2nd stitch!!

After...



These little shelves look like they were handmade. This was after I sanded them down.

Before...


I just gave them a coat of light grey paint.

After...


This is a vintage stadium chair. It would be good for picnics too... but it just didn't look too appealing with the old yellow and black vinyl. I had already taken the vinyl off the back rest. Oops!

Before...


I used some oil cloth I had and some pom-pom trims. Isn't it cute now?

After...


I didn't get before pictures of the next two items... but this one was just an old spool for wire or cable or something. I used a few yard sticks and cut them to fit the center portion.

After...


And what once was just an old bicycle wheel is now a cute spring wreath!

After...
